Dedicated to the implementation for the c4-5 months it takes, you will drive the territory/region adoption of Vantage using a consistent implementation framework and support model
Consult with the territory/region to help them understand the change required relating to the implementation of Vantage, and to ensure they are positioned for success on their go live day
Lead the virtual kick off call to explain what happens during implementation, what the key steps are, and the key sign off points
Lead the onsite workshop where:
the Vantage homepage is designed
business process As Is - To Be is wireframed
the territory/region are upskilled on content curation processes
the Global Learning Taxonomy is explained as well as ongoing governance
Work with the Global technical representative to ensure that any Cornerstone configuration changes required are done against timelines with adequate risk management
Ensure Vantage functional knowledge is always updated, including Watershed LRS, ContentSphere, and Vantage mobile
Ensure knowledge of Global learning content management processes are up to date
Join implementation team calls to share and gather knowledge from colleagues
Escalate issues, concerns to Vantage Service Delivery Manager in a timely manner.

Internal firm services
In order to deliver a first-class service to our clients, we need first-class support internally. Internal firm services is a network of specialist support professionals and includes marketing, recruitment, human capital, finance, technology, learning and development, procurement, to name but a few. Each team plays a vital role in making sure we have all the right resources, services and technology across our business.
The skills we look for in future employees
All our people need to demonstrate the skills and behaviours that support us in delivering our business strategy. This is important to the work we do for our business, and our clients. These skills and behaviours make up our global leadership framework, 'The PwC Professional' and are made up of five core attributes; whole leadership, technical capabilities, business acumen, global acumen and relationships.
